Incident occurred at Renton Municipal Airport (KRNT), Washington

The runway at Renton Municipal Airport was closed for about an hour following an accident involving a single-engine plane.

No one was injured and no fuel was spilled in the incident.

According to Airport Manager Ryan Zulauf, the pilot of a single-engine Cessna was practicing "touch-and-gos" when the plane exited the runway. A touch-and-go is a practice landing in which the pilot lands the plane, but immediately takes off again before stopping the engine.
